Valldoreix: A Hidden Gem of Nature's Embrace and Cultural Wonder

Nestled in the rolling hills of Catalonia, Valldoreix, part of Sant Cugat del Vallès, is a serene escape for nature lovers and culture seekers alike. This charming residential area boasts picturesque landscapes, lush parks, and inviting walking trails, perfect for leisurely strolls or picnics. Just a stone's throw from the vibrant city of Barcelona, Valldoreix offers a peaceful retreat while remaining conveniently connected via the local train station. Discover the area's rich history through its quaint architecture and enjoy the warm Catalan hospitality, making it an ideal spot for a romantic getaway or a tranquil day trip.

When Is the Best Time to Visit Sant Cugat del Valles?

  • Hottest months: July, August, June, September (average 74°F)
  • Coldest months: January, February, December, March (average 49°F)
  • Rainiest months: October, September, April, November (average 3 inches of rainfall)
